7. New shortcut to toggle input sources for channels 9-16.

Previous Versions: Selection of Analog mic/line input sources 9-16 or the
inputs from CARD SLOT #3 were only selectable from the [D-I/O>INPUT
SET] window.

Version 2.0: Analog mic/line inputs 9-16 can be toggled between the inputs
from CARD SLOT #3 by pressing the MMC/CURSOR button and the D-I/O
button simultaneously. This is an easy way to switch from your tracking
inputs to your tape returns, if you are recording 24 tracks. Another
application would be using the ADDA card in SLOT 3 as additional analog
inputs from a remote location. This shortcut now allows you easy access to
these multiple inputs.

8. New Shortcut to the MONITOR A DIM function.

Previous Versions: The MONITOR A DIM was only adjustable from within
the [SOLO/MONITOR] window.

Version 2.0: By pressing the MMC/CURSOR button and the SOLO MONITOR
button simultaneously, MONITOR A will DIM (attenuate) by 20dB.

9. Parameter changes can now be made by using the JOG DIAL when
the MMC or CURSOR mode is enabled.

Previous Versions: To change any of the parameters of a Soft Knob or
addressable box in the LCD display, while MMC or CURSOR was enabled, you
must first turn off the MMC or CURSOR function to make the changes using
the JOG DIAL.

Version 2.0: This has been changed so that even if MMC is ENABLED, or the
JOG DIAL is in CURSOR mode, the JOG DIAL can be used to change the
parameters of a soft knob, or an addressable box in the LCD display, by first
selecting the box, and by pressing ENTER. The JOG DIAL can now enter data
in the selected field. Press ENTER again to return to the previous mode.
